(02-06-2012, 12:39 PM)plenum Wrote: I think Ra brings in some terminology here:
the manifest self - when one interacts with another being
the unmanifest self - when one is sitting in one's room thinking awesome thoughts
Quote:71.5 The activities of meditation, contemplation, and what may be called the internal balancing of thoughts and reactions are those activities of the unmanifested self more closely aligned with the metaphysical self.
The manifest/unmanifested self terms make perfect sense and I see how they are co-dependent on one another. The thoughts the unmanifested self thinks lead to the actions the manifested self executes, and from those actions executed the corresponding reality is created, and that reality created by the manifested self will lead to the formation of mental constructs (feelings/emotions, perspectives, biases, thoughts in general) by the unmanifested self, which in turn will lead to further action by the manifested self determined by the thoughts created from the previous interaction between the two, which will perpetually continue in a loop of each sustaining the existence of the other!
Quote:and Ra also talks about Wanderers coming back to 3rd Density to INCREASE their polarization
Quote:52.9 The Wanderer, if it remembers and dedicates itself to service, will polarize much more rapidly than is possible in the far more etiolated realms of higher density catalyst.
this is consistent with your assertion or premise that one needs to have the veil/illusion of separateness to develop the sense of Service-to-Others, because the 'other' is much more real and 'separate' in this density.
if all is seen and known as One in higher densities, there is a more difficult grasping of the concept of 'other'. In 3d it is most real.
Precisely! Everyone looks, acts, thinks and feels differently but it needs to be recognized that it is just one being wearing different masks present in every interaction.
